上篇介紹到任務調度框架Quartz,此次介紹下Spring自帶定時器@Scheduled 1、使用方法,在需要執行的方法上添加@Scheduled注解 @EnableScheduling @Component public class QuartzService ...
.僅需引入spring相關的包。 .在xml里加入task的命名空間 .配置定時任務的線程池 .寫定時任務 總結: .配置定時任務線程池可以同時執行同一時間的任務,否則是按照順序執行。 .如果xml里面開啟的懶加載,default lazy init true ,需要有 Lazy false 注解 ...
2017-04-10 14:23 0 7394 推薦指數:
上篇介紹到任務調度框架Quartz,此次介紹下Spring自帶定時器@Scheduled 1、使用方法,在需要執行的方法上添加@Scheduled注解 @EnableScheduling @Component public class QuartzService ...
摘要: 在coding中經常會用到定時器,指定每隔1個小時,或是每天凌晨2點執行一段代碼段,若是使用java.util.Timer來做這種事情,未免重復造輪子。幸虧Spring中封裝有定時器,而且非常好用, 采用注解的形式配置某時某刻執行一段代碼段。在之前的項目中使用過一次, 下面就把 ...
一、使用quartz 1.由於我的項目jar包使用的maven托管的,在pom文件中加入quartz的依賴就可以 2.配置quartz-context.xml,確保xml文件能被加載到 <?xml version="1.0" encoding="UTF-8"?>< ...
一、注解方式 1. 在Spring的配置文件ApplicationContext.xml,首先添加命名空間 2. 最后是我們的task任務掃描注解 1 <task:annotation-driven/> 3. spring掃描位置 ...
1...pom.xml 文件配置 2...applicationContext.xml 3...web.xml 4...java 代碼 5...啟動tomcat 測試 運行結果 6...cron 表達式 ...
摘要: Spring Boot之使用@Scheduled定時器任務 假設我們已經搭建好了一個基於Spring Boot項目,首先我們要在Application中設置啟用定時任務功能 ...
摘要: Spring Boot之使用 @Scheduled定時器任務 假設我們已經搭建好了一個基於Spring Boot項目,首先我們要在Application中設置啟用定時任務功能@EnableScheduling。 啟動定時 ...